Specifications Breakdown

Model: Bluvall V1  

Bike Type: Dual-motor fat-tire electric bike  

Colour: Black, Green, Khaki  

Motor Power: 1000W dual motor  

Torque: 160 Nm  

Top Speed: Up to 56 km/h (35 mph)  

Battery: Removable 52V 22.4Ah lithium battery  

Battery Capacity: 1,075Wh  

Range: Up to 97 km (60 miles) with pedal assist  

Throttle Range: Up to 72 km (45 miles)  

Charging Time: Approx. 7–8 hours  

Wheel Size: 26-inch wheels  

Tyres: 26 × 4.0-inch all-terrain fat tyres  

Suspension: Full suspension  

Front Suspension: Dual-crown suspension fork  

Rear Suspension: Heavy-duty rear shock  

Brakes: Front and rear hydraulic disc brakes  

Brake Rotor Size: 180 mm front and rear  

Display: Backlit LCD display  

USB Charging Port: Yes  

Assist Modes: 5 pedal-assist levels  

Throttle: Pure electric throttle mode  

Lighting: Front LED headlight, rear light, and turn signals  

Frame Material: 6061 aluminium alloy high-step frame  

Maximum Load: 180 kg (397 lbs)  

Bike Weight: Approx. 37 kg (82 lbs) with battery installed  

Recommended Rider Height: Approx. 170–201 cm (5 ft 7 in–6 ft 7 in)  

Extra Features: Full fender set and plush saddle included

The BLUVALL V1

The Bluvall V1 Electric Bike is built for riders who want premium all-terrain capability, long-range confidence, and a more substantial ride feel for both everyday journeys and outdoor adventure. Designed with a rugged 6061 aluminium alloy high-step frame, it offers a strong and stable foundation that feels equally at home on city streets, rougher roads, and trail routes. This is a bike made for riders who want comfort, endurance, and versatility in one high-spec package.

A major highlight of the V1 is its 52V 22.4Ah removable lithium battery, offering around 1,075Wh of capacity. This supports a claimed range of up to 60 miles on pedal assist or around 45 miles in throttle mode, depending on rider weight, terrain, weather, and riding style. The removable battery design makes charging more convenient, while the generous capacity gives riders more freedom for longer commutes, weekend rides, and full-day adventures with fewer charging stops.

Comfort and control are central to the riding experience. The V1 is equipped with a dual-crown suspension fork and a heavy-duty rear shock, helping to smooth out bumps, rough surfaces, and uneven terrain for a more planted and comfortable ride. This is paired with 26-inch fat all-terrain tyres, which add grip, balance, and confidence across gravel, dirt, sand, snow, and broken pavement. Together, these features make the bike especially appealing for riders who want a more capable ride than a typical urban e-bike.

For safety and practicality, the bike features hydraulic disc brakes for strong and dependable stopping power, along with an integrated lighting system that includes turn signals to improve visibility and rider awareness. Altogether, the Bluvall V1 combines long-range battery performance, rugged suspension comfort, and fat-tire versatility in a premium electric bike designed for riders who want endurance, stability, and all-terrain confidence.
